We have an open problem with CVS HEAD that ALTER TABLE SET WITHOUT OIDS causes problems: http://archives.postgresql.org/pgsql-hackers/2008-11/msg00332.php
I opined at the time that what we really have here is a table whose tuples do not match its declared rowtype, and that the proper fix is to make SET WITHOUT OIDS rewrite the table to physically get rid of the OIDs. The attached patch (which lacks doc changes or regression tests as yet) does that, and also adds the inverse SET WITH OIDS operation to do what you'd expect, ie, add an OID column if it isn't there already. The major objection to this would probably be that SET WITHOUT OIDS has historically been a "free" catalog-change operation, and now it will be expensive on large tables. But given that we've deprecated OIDs in user tables since 8.0, I think most people have been through that conversion already, or have decided to keep their OIDs anyway. I don't think it's worth taking a continuing risk of backend bugs in order to make life a bit easier for any remaining laggards. A different discussion is whether it's appropriate to put in SET WITH OIDS now, when we're well past feature freeze. If we stripped that out of this patch it'd save a few dozen lines of code, but I'm not really seeing the point. The asymmetry of having SET WITHOUT and not SET WITH has always been an implementation artifact anyway. Comments? regards, tom lane
